Why Choose a Private ADHD Diagnosis?
Selecting a private ADHD diagnosis can offer a number of benefits:

Reduced Waiting Times: Public health care systems can have long waiting lists for ADHD Diagnosis Adult evaluations. A private diagnosis can frequently be set up far more quickly.

Thorough Assessments: Many personal specialists utilize a holistic approach, assessing not just the signs of ADHD however also co-occurring conditions.

Personalized Care: Private assessments might permit one-on-one consultations that provide a deeper understanding of the person's special circumstance.

Access to Specialists: Private centers often have access to specialists who might have comprehensive experience with ADHD.
Breakdown of Costs
The cost of a private ADHD diagnosis can vary extensively depending upon numerous elements, consisting of geographical location, the kind of specialist, and the specific assessments carried out. Below is an in-depth breakdown of typical costs connected with personal ADHD medical diagnoses.
Table 1: Average Costs of Private ADHD DiagnosisServiceCost Range (in GBP)Initial Consultation₤ 150 - ₤ 300Comprehensive Assessment₤ 500 - ₤ 2,500Psychological Testing₤ 200 - ₤ 1,000Follow-Up Appointment₤ 100 - ₤ 250Medication Management (if prescribed)₤ 100 - ₤ 300 (per month)Factors Influencing Pricing
Kind of Practitioner: Costs will vary depending on whether the evaluation is conducted by a psychologist, psychiatrist, or pediatrician. Psychiatrists might charge more due to their medical training.

Area: Urban locations tend to have actually greater fees compared to rural places. For example, personal assessments in cities like New York or Los Angeles may be at the higher end of the spectrum.

Evaluation Depth: A thorough examination will likely consist of numerous tests, questionnaires, and perhaps even interviews with instructors or relative, all of which can increase expenses.

Insurance coverage Coverage: Some private service providers might accept insurance, which can considerably decrease out-of-pocket expenses. It's important to contact both the company and your insurance provider regarding protection.
What Does a Private ADHD Diagnosis Typically Include?
When pursuing a private ADHD Diagnosis UK Adults assessment, people can expect a structured procedure. The following list lays out the common parts associated with a comprehensive examination.
List: Components of a Private ADHD Diagnosis
Preliminary Screening: Completing self-report questionnaires or lists to determine symptoms.

Medical Interview: An extensive conversation with the clinician about symptoms, medical history, family history, and social background.

Behavioral Assessments: These might consist of additional standardized tests or rating scales finished by moms and dads, teachers, or caregivers.

Psychological Testing: To examine cognitive function and rule out other conditions, standardized psychological tests may be administered.

Feedback Session: A follow-up appointment to talk about the results and possible treatment alternatives.
